/**
 * InitializerDisplay - Displays model initializers (constant tensors / weights)
 * Requirements: 7.1, 7.2, 7.3, 7.4, 7.5
 */

class InitializerDisplay {
  /**
   * @param {string} containerId - ID of the container element
   */
  constructor(containerId) {
    this._containerId = containerId;
    this._container = document.getElementById(containerId);

    if (!this._container) {
      console.warn(`[InitializerDisplay] Container #${containerId} not found`);
    }
  }

  // ─── Private ──────────────────────────────────────────────────────────────

  /**
   * Escape HTML special characters.
   * @param {string} str
   * @returns {string}
   */
  _escapeHtml(str) {
    const div = document.createElement('div');
    div.appendChild(document.createTextNode(String(str)));
    return div.innerHTML;
  }

  /**
   * Format a shape array to a readable string.
   * @param {Array<number>} shape
   * @returns {string}
   */
  _formatShape(shape) {
    if (!shape || shape.length === 0) return '[]';
    return `[${shape.join(', ')}]`;
  }

  /**
   * Resolve a numeric data type to its string name.
   * @param {number|string} dataType
   * @returns {string}
   */
  _resolveDataType(dataType) {
    if (typeof dataType === 'string') return dataType;
    if (CONFIG && CONFIG.DATA_TYPES && CONFIG.DATA_TYPES[dataType]) {
      return CONFIG.DATA_TYPES[dataType];
    }
    return String(dataType);
  }

  /**
   * Format a byte count to a human-readable string (e.g. "4.2 KB").
   * @param {number} bytes
   * @returns {string}
   */
  _formatBytes(bytes) {
    if (bytes === 0) return '0 B';
    const k = 1024;
    const sizes = ['B', 'KB', 'MB', 'GB'];
    const i = Math.floor(Math.log(bytes) / Math.log(k));
    return `${parseFloat((bytes / Math.pow(k, i)).toFixed(2))} ${sizes[i]}`;
  }

  /**
   * Compute the size label for an initializer.
   * Prefer size in bytes; fall back to element count.
   * @param {InitializerInfo} init
   * @returns {string}
   */
  _sizeLabel(init) {
    if (init.size && init.size > 0) {
      return this._formatBytes(init.size);
    }
    if (init.elementCount && init.elementCount > 0) {
      return `${init.elementCount.toLocaleString()} elements`;
    }
    // Compute element count from shape if available
    if (init.shape && init.shape.length > 0) {
      const count = init.shape.reduce((acc, d) => acc * (d || 1), 1);
      return `${count.toLocaleString()} elements`;
    }
    return 'Unknown size';
  }

  /**
   * Build the HTML for a single initializer item.
   * @param {InitializerInfo} init
   * @returns {string}
   */
  _buildItem(init) {
    const shape = this._formatShape(init.shape);
    const dtype = this._resolveDataType(init.dataType);
    const size = this._sizeLabel(init);

    return `
      <div class="initializer-item border rounded p-2 mb-2 cursor-pointer"
           role="button"
           tabindex="0"
           data-init-name="${this._escapeHtml(init.name)}"
           title="Click to highlight in graph"
           aria-label="Initializer ${this._escapeHtml(init.name)}">
        <div class="fw-medium text-truncate mb-1">${this._escapeHtml(init.name)}</div>
        <div class="small text-muted d-flex flex-wrap gap-2">
          <span><i class="fas fa-shapes me-1"></i>${this._escapeHtml(shape)}</span>
          <span><i class="fas fa-tag me-1"></i>${this._escapeHtml(dtype)}</span>
          <span><i class="fas fa-database me-1"></i>${this._escapeHtml(size)}</span>
        </div>
      </div>`;
  }

  /**
   * Attach click and keyboard handlers to initializer items.
   */
  _attachItemHandlers() {
    if (!this._container) return;
    const items = this._container.querySelectorAll('.initializer-item');
    items.forEach((item) => {
      const handler = () => {
        const name = item.dataset.initName;
        if (name && window.EventBus) {
          window.EventBus.emit(CONFIG.EVENTS.NODE_SELECTED, { nodeId: name, source: 'initializer' });
        }
        if (name && window.StateManager) {
          window.StateManager.setSelectedNodeId(name);
        }
      };
      item.addEventListener('click', handler);
      item.addEventListener('keydown', (e) => {
        if (e.key === 'Enter' || e.key === ' ') {
          e.preventDefault();
          handler();
        }
      });
    });
  }

  // ─── Public API ───────────────────────────────────────────────────────────

  /**
   * Render the initializer list for a parsed model.
   * @param {ParsedModel} model
   */
  render(model) {
    if (!this._container) return;

    const initializers = (model && model.initializers)
      ? model.initializers
      : (model && model.graph && model.graph.initializers)
        ? model.graph.initializers
        : [];

    if (initializers.length === 0) {
      this._container.innerHTML = `
        <p class="text-muted">
          <i class="fas fa-info-circle me-1"></i>No initializers found in this model.
        </p>`;
      return;
    }

    const header = `<p class="text-secondary small mb-2">${initializers.length} initializer${initializers.length !== 1 ? 's' : ''}</p>`;
    const items = initializers.map((init) => this._buildItem(init)).join('');

    this._container.innerHTML = header + items;
    this._attachItemHandlers();
  }

  /**
   * Clear the display.
   */
  clear() {
    if (!this._container) return;
    this._container.innerHTML = '<p class="text-muted">Select a model to view initializers</p>';
  }
}

window.InitializerDisplay = InitializerDisplay;
